One more suggestion. The notation you are using is neither the classical nor the algebraic form, and to be frank, it's confusing to someone who uses either of the standard ones. For example, K stands for King in both systems, but you are using it for for both King and Knight.

The following would be an improvement.

1) Along the left border, running from White towards Black, number the rows (ranks) 1 through 8.

2) Along the bottom border, running from left to right, label the files (columns) a through h.

With that standard setup, each square is clearly and uniquely identified by specifying a letter following by a number, such as e4.

Then you can use whatever you want to. If you want to spend the time to learn the peculiarities of algebraic notation you could, or you could simply continue to list the "from" square and the "to" square.
